>I am suffering vignetting in four corners of the image with the following
>combination: EOS3, EF 20mm f2.8 USM and B+W 72 Circular polarization filter
>F-Pro. Removing the (original) lens hood doesn't help and the filter is
>visually clean (holding the filter againts the light) besides some minor /
>transparent and cristal like contamination when I look through the viewer,
>most critically. So little that I cannot imagine this is the root cause.

Could be that the filter thread is getting slightly into the FOV. The EOS 3
does not have a 100% viewfinder (though close to) which can make a bit a
difference in particular if you shoot slides. Also a 20mm lens has quite a
big FOV so the polarizer will have a different effect in the middle of the
FOV and at the border of the FOV. Since the corners are quite a bit futher
away from the center then the middle of the four sides the brighness will
not be even along the four sides.
